Answer:

C) Not enough information or not similar.

Step-by-step explanation:

Actually, those figures don't provide enough information to know is they can be similar, and we cannot know which postulate can be used to demonstrate such similarity.

To demonstrate a similarity by SSS, we need a proportionality between all corresponding three side, which we don't have because we don't know about the measure of neither side.

To demonstrate it by AA, we need the congruence between two corresponding triangles, which we don't have, the image doesn't provide it.

To demonstrate it by SAS, we need the congruence of one corresponding angle, and the proportion between two corresponding sides, we also don't have in this case.

Therefore, the right answer would be C.
